Welcome to the Rural Health Transformation Program (RHTP) Newsletter!
The Oregon Health Authority (OHA) is excited to introduce the Rural Health Transformation Program (RHTP)—a new, federally funded initiative designed to support long-term, community-driven improvements in rural health systems across the United States.
|
|
|
The RHTP was established through H.R.1, the federal budget reconciliation bill signed into law on July 4, 2025. In addition to broader changes to Medicaid and SNAP, H.R.1 created this one-time, five-year program to fund rural health transformation efforts nationwide.
Oregon submitted its application to CMS and is currently awaiting a funding decision, expected by December 31, 2025.
